RPD Boost showing "Data Not Available"

Recently purchased my Cobalt SS.
After some distance and a stop for lunch, on the next engine on, the RPD Boost screen was showing "Data Not Available" in the middle of the gauge.

So my first story with the new toy is to fix this issue.
Seems to be simple, since the car is working.

Any idea on how to fix that?
Sensor? Where?

Thanks a lot.

Code showed intake manifold pressure error. Disconnected, reconnected, cleared error and everything seems to be working again. Quick note, it is the 3 bar sensor. Came with the car when I bought it.
